Analysis. Romeo comes out of hiding just as a light in a nearby window flicks on and Juliet exits onto her balcony. "It is the east," Romeo says, regarding Juliet, "and Juliet is the sun .". He urges the sun to rise and "kill the envious moon .". He urges Juliet to take her "vestal livery" and "cast it off.". In Act 1, Romeo's most pronounced qualities are his petulance and capriciousness. His friends (and potentially, the audience) find Romeo's melancholy mood to be grating, and are confused when he quickly forgets Rosaline to fall madly in love with Juliet. Symbols. Quotes. Written and first published at the end of the sixteenth century, Romeo and Juliet is Shakespeare's best-known romantic tragedy. The play tells the story of a young couple from rival families in medieval Verona, Italy, and the inevitable ecstasy and doom of their whirlwind romance. Romeo and Juliet Act 2 Test Review.
